§ Do not extend or modify the supplied 2.5 m power cord. § Do not connect electrical systems that are not authorised by ZEISS on the supplied power sup- ply cord. Value Nominal AC voltage 1/N/PE 220-240 V AC (+/- 10%) / 100 - 125 V AC (+/- 10%)
In areas where the mains supply is very unstable or not very clean, the most stable mode of UPS is the online mode, where the UPS constantly generates the output mains supply. 2.5.2 Biosafety Level of the Laboratory The customer should inform ZEISS of the biosafety level of the installation site. Access to the sys- tem, safety training, correct safety dress code and use of tools and test equipment needs to be clarified for specified laboratories (World Health Organisation Laboratory Biosafety Manual 3).
Active damping tables require compressed air to isolate the system from floor vibrations. The nec- essary compressed air can be either generated by a compressor (please ask your ZEISS sales and service representative) or taken from a gas cylinder or from an in-house supply system.
ZEISS 2.7 Cooling System The detection modules in your Lightsheet 7 are connected to a liquid cooling system. A cooling liquid defined as a hazardous substance is used to cool the detection modules (depending on con- figuration). The supplied safety data sheet with notes on hazards and safety measures must be observed when handling the cooling liquid.
